diff options
| author | Alex Deucher <alexander.deucher@amd.com> | 2025-08-13 21:53:50 +0300 |
|---|---|---|
| committer | Alex Deucher <alexander.deucher@amd.com> | 2025-08-27 20:57:49 +0300 |
| commit | fa064d50b7eee6f40749ff03de7ef99ff4acc8c9 (patch) | |
| tree | d47c0a5cea980ea9024cbca44fc61112ffa6f08b /drivers/gpu/drm/amd/amdgpu/amdgpu_vcn.c | |
| parent | f3820e9d356132e18405cd7606e22dc87ccfa6d1 (diff) | |
| download | linux-fa064d50b7eee6f40749ff03de7ef99ff4acc8c9.tar.xz | |
drm/amdgpu/vcn: drop extra cancel_delayed_work_sync()
We already call this in the hw_fini() methods for all
VCN instances, so no need to call it again in
amdgpu_vcn_suspend().
Tested-by: David (Ming Qiang) Wu <David.Wu3@amd.com>
Reviewed-by: Leo Liu <leo.liu@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
Diffstat (limited to 'drivers/gpu/drm/amd/amdgpu/amdgpu_vcn.c')
| -rw-r--r-- | drivers/gpu/drm/amd/amdgpu/amdgpu_vcn.c | 2 |
1 files changed, 0 insertions, 2 deletions
di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u_vcn.c b/drivers/gpu/drm/amd/amdgpu/amdgpu_vcn.c index 9a76e11d1c18..fd8ebf4b5a82 100644 --- a/drivers/gpu/drm/amd/amdgpu/amdgpu_vcn.c +++ b/drivers/gpu/drm/amd/amdgpu/amdgpu_vcn.c @@ -357,8 +357,6 @@ int amdgpu_vcn_suspend(struct amdgpu_device *adev, int i) if (adev->vcn.harvest_config & (1 << i)) return 0; - cancel_delayed_work_sync(&adev->vcn.inst[i].idle_work); - /* err_event_athub and dpc recovery will corrupt VCPU buffer, so we need to * restore fw data and clear buffer in amdgpu_vcn_resume() */ if (in_ras_intr || adev->pcie_reset_ctx.in_link_reset) |
